/// Determine if user has configured a sandbox / approval policy,
/// or if the current cwd project is trusted, and updates the config
/// accordingly.
fn determine_repo_trust_state(
config: &mut Config,
config_toml: &ConfigToml,
approval_policy_overide: Option<AskForApproval>,
sandbox_mode_override: Option<SandboxMode>,
config_profile_override: Option<String>,
) -> std::io::Result<bool> {
let config_profile = config_toml.get_config_profile(config_profile_override)?;
if approval_policy_overide.is_some() || sandbox_mode_override.is_some() {
// if the user has overridden either approval policy or sandbox mode,
// skip the trust flow
Ok(false)
} else if config_profile.approval_policy.is_some() {
// if the user has specified settings in a config profile, skip the trust flow
// todo: profile sandbox mode?
Ok(false)
} else if config_toml.approval_policy.is_some() || config_toml.sandbox_mode.is_some() {
// if the user has specified either approval policy or sandbox mode in config.toml
// skip the trust flow
Ok(false)
} else if config_toml.is_cwd_trusted(&config.cwd) {
// if the current cwd project is trusted and no config has been set
// skip the trust flow and set the approval policy and sandbox mode
config.approval_policy = AskForApproval::OnRequest;
config.sandbox_policy = SandboxPolicy::new_workspace_write_policy();
Ok(false)
} else {
// if none of the above conditions are met, show the trust screen
Ok(true)
}
}
